Chocolate Clusters

Source: Galynn Zitnik
Time: 10 minutes to assemble, hours to cool
Yield: as many as you want

Easy to make and good for Christmas presents.

Ingredients:
Semi-sweet chocolate bars or chips
Fillings:
     Dried fruits (raisins, cranberries, apricots, cherries, berries, etc.)
     Orange zest
     Nuts (walnuts, hazelnuts, almonds, pecans, peanuts, etc.)
     Dried, grated coconut
     Crisped rice
     Extracts (peppermint, almond, vanilla, etc.)
     Peppermint candies, crushed
     Caramel candies, chopped
     Flavored chips (white chocolate, peanut butter, mint, etc.)
     M&M's or Reises' pieces

Melt chocolate in the microwave on low, stirring frequently. Mix in your choice of filling. Spoon onto wax paper or aluminum foil and let dry at room temperature until hard and cool. (You may refrigerate or freeze them too, but these will melt in your fingers)
